Increasing Lung Cancer Burden Necessitates Robust Diagnostic Solutions

Lung cancer is one of the most commonly diagnosed cancers in Australia, ranking among the leading causes of cancer-related mortality in both men and women. According to the Australian Institute of Health and Welfare (AIHW), over 14,500 new cases of lung cancer were diagnosed in 2023. This increasing disease burden underpins the demand for accurate, accessible, and early-stage diagnostic tools.

The shift toward non-invasive and minimally invasive diagnostic techniques, such as liquid biopsies and advanced imaging systems, is reshaping clinical workflows. Early diagnosis is critical for improving survival rates, which makes diagnostics the most crucial component in the lung cancer care continuum.


Key Market Drivers Accelerating Growth

1. Advancement in Diagnostic Technologies

Modern technologies such as low-dose CT (LDCT) scanning, PET-CT, next-generation sequencing (NGS), and biomarker testing are significantly enhancing diagnostic accuracy and efficiency. Integration of AI tools for image analysis is reducing radiologist workload while increasing diagnostic precision.

2. Government Programs and Screening Initiatives

The Australian Government has implemented nationwide lung cancer screening pilots and awareness programs, especially targeting high-risk populations such as smokers and individuals with occupational exposure to asbestos. These initiatives are driving the adoption of preventive diagnostics.

3. Aging Population

Australia’s aging population presents a growing target segment for lung cancer diagnostics. Older adults are more susceptible to lung cancer, increasing the need for screening services tailored to this demographic.

4. Improved Access to Healthcare Services

The expansion of diagnostic centers, improved reimbursement policies, and growing investment in regional healthcare infrastructure have broadened access to advanced diagnostic services across both urban and rural regions.


Australia Lung Cancer Diagnostics Market: Segmentation Analysis

By Type of Test

  • Imaging Tests (CT, MRI, PET Scans): Dominates the market owing to widespread use for tumor localization and staging.

  • Biopsy and Histopathology: Gold standard for definitive diagnosis and classification of lung cancer types.

  • Molecular Diagnostics: Gaining traction due to their role in identifying mutations and guiding targeted therapies.

  • Sputum Cytology and Blood Tests: Non-invasive and used primarily for screening and monitoring.

By Cancer Type

  •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er (NSCLC): Accounts for over 85% of all lung cancer diagnoses, thereby dominating diagnostic demand.

  • Small Cell Lung Cancer (SCLC): Though less common, its aggressive nature requires rapid diagnostic intervention.

Challenges Restraining Market Growth

While the future of lung cancer diagnostics in Australia appears promising, several barriers remain:

  • High Cost of Advanced Diagnostics: Despite government reimbursement programs, the cost of next-gen sequencing, PET scans, and other molecular tests remains high for some patient segments.

  • Skilled Workforce Shortage: The lack of trained radiologists and pathologists, especially in rural areas, limits access to high-quality diagnostics.

  • Limited Awareness in Certain Demographics: Low levels of awareness and screening uptake among marginalized or remote populations create gaps in early detection.

  • Data Privacy and AI Regulation: As AI tools become more prominent, regulatory concerns around data usage, security, and algorithm transparency are increasing.


Emerging Trends to Watch

1. AI and Machine Learning in Imaging

AI tools are being used to enhance image recognition and risk stratification, enabling earlier detection of pulmonary nodules and minimizing false positives.

2. Liquid Biopsy Adoption

Liquid biopsies using blood samples offer a non-invasive method to detect lung cancer biomarkers and monitor treatment response in real time.

3. Personalized Medicine

Tailoring diagnostic and treatment strategies based on a patient’s genetic profile is becoming standard in lung cancer management.

4. Public-Private Collaborations

Partnerships between tech companies, government health departments, and academic institutions are fostering innovation and accessibility.
